How well does this type of urban outdoor furniture resist scratches from pets?

Urban outdoor furniture designed for modern living spaces often incorporates materials specifically engineered to withstand various forms of wear, including scratches from pets. The resistance level largely depends on the primary construction material. Powder-coated aluminum and wrought iron typically offer excellent scratch resistance, with hard, baked-on finishes that deflect most claws. Synthetic wicker made from high-density polyethylene (HDPE) is also highly resilient, as the woven strands are difficult for pets to snag and tear. For wood options, teak and acacia hold up better than softer woods, though deep scratches can occur. The most vulnerable materials are softer woods and certain plastics. Many manufacturers now apply textured or distressed finishes that cleverly mask minor scuffs. For optimal durability, look for furniture labeled as having a high rub count (e.g., 30,000+ double rubs) in its finish. Regular nail trimming for pets and using protective covers or throws on seating surfaces can further minimize visible damage. Ultimately, while no material is completely impervious, selecting furniture with hard, non-porous surfaces and robust coatings significantly enhances scratch resistance in pet-friendly urban environments.
